Financial Audit is independent examination of the financial statements of entity (profit-oriented or not) irrespective of the size of entity by auditors or audit firm to provide opinion regarding the true and fair view of the facts & figures mentioned in the financial statements of the entity and to obtain reasonable assurance regarding whether the financial statement is free from any material misstatement. It is always conducted by a competent auditor or group of auditors who are independent of the entity so that the observation and opinion provided by the auditors will remain unbiased and provide true opinion towards the practices and procedures adopted by the management. Audit procedures are used by auditors to determine the quality of the financial information being provided by their clients, resulting in the expression of an auditor’s opinion. It does not provide absolute proof that the final accounts are free of any material misstatement because of the inherent audit limitations that provide satisfactory and reasonable assurance regarding the information mentioned in the financial statements. After the completion of the audit step to be done by auditors for gathering sufficient audit evidence, the auditor provides his opinion regarding the financial statement and internal control of the entity in his audit report and consolidates his audit evidence for safekeeping.
